|
| Boolsche Variablen, isset, isempty |
|
Ausführen
<< >> |
|
| |
|
<html>
<head><title>Online PHP-Kurs</title></head>
<body>
<?
// mögliche Zustände von Variablen:
// es gibt in PHP keine Fehlermeldung wenn man auf ungesetzte
// Variablen zugreift. Mit isset kann abgefragt werden, ob eine
// Variable getzt ist
echo $var;
echo "isset: ",isset($var),"<br>";
$var="";
// mit empty() kann abgefragt werden, ob eine Variable leer ist.
// 0 oder "" werden z. B. als leer interpretiert
echo "isset: ",isset($var),"<br>";
echo "empty: ",empty($var),"<br>";
$var="0";
echo "isset: ",isset($var),"<br>";
echo "empty: ",empty($var),"<br>";
// boolsche Variablen werden als integer gespeichert.
// "" gilt als false, 1 als true.
$var=(3>4);
echo "\nvar: $var\n<br>";
echo "isset: ",isset($var),"<br>";
echo "empty: ",empty($var),"<br>";
echo "is_bool: ", is_bool($var),"<br>";
$var=(4>3);
echo "\nvar: $var\n<br>";
echo "isset: ",isset($var),"<br>";
echo "empty: ",empty($var),"<br>";
// mit is_bool kann abgefragt werden, ob eine Variable einen
// als bool-Wert interpretierbaren Inhalt hat.
echo "is_bool: ", is_bool($var),"<br>";
?>
</body>
</html>
|
|
Diese PHP-Schulung und fortgeschrittene Themen können Sie auch in einem Training durchführen.
|
| |
|
| |
|
|